Learning Outcomes
By the end of the course, the student must be able to:
- Design and deliver a well-structured presentation suitable for an academic context
 - Integrate relevant and effective gestures and visual aids into presentations
 - Use appropriate pronunciation techniques for pausing, stress and intonation
 - Integrate strategies for asking and answering questions competently and efficiently
 - Assess / Evaluate own presentation skills and provide others with constructive feedback
 - Construct and apply appropriate academic vocabulary
 - Respond and express ideas and opinions, participate in academic discussions
